CNBC confirms that someone did indeed march up to Lehman Brothers CEO Dick Fuld and "knock him out cold" right after the bankruptcy was announced. Said Vanity Fair's Vicki Ward: "I'd have done the same too." In the CNBC video below, Ward discusses Fuld's apparent lack of contrition over his shambolic mismanagement of the company, and notes that the rumor of Fuld getting decked has been confirmed by two extremely reliable sources.
